HAZEL WALLING

Hazel Walling

12:01 a.m. PT May 2, 2007
A visitation will be held between 9 and 11 a.m. on Friday, May 4, at Hooper and Weaver Mortuary in Nevada City for Hazel Louise Faulkner Walling. A graveside service will follow at 11 a.m at Sierra Memorial Lawn. At 12:30 p.m., there will be a memorial service, with a reception following, at the Penn Valley Community Church. Pastor William R. White, Mrs. Walling's great-grandson, will officiate. Mrs. Walling passed away with her family by her side April 28 in Auburn. She was 92.

Mrs. Walling was born Aug. 30, 1914, to Jefferson Wilce Faulkner and Nora Alice Lucas Faulkner in Tennessee. She completed the 11th grade at White Sand School in Bryan County, Okla.

On Nov. 22, 1932, she married Bob Walling in Darwin, Okla. Mrs. Walling was a homemaker and ranch hand with her husband on their cattle ranch in Missouri.

She moved from Lebanon, Mo., to California in 1993. In Nevada County, Mrs. Walling attended the Lutz Adult Day Services where she looked on the staff and her fellow participants as her second family.

She was a member of the Eastern Star in Morris, Okla., the Home Demonstration Club in Henryetta, Okla., and the Church of Christ in Grass Valley. In her free time, she enjoyed hunting, fishing, crocheting and gardening.

Mrs. Walling is survived by her brother and sister-in-law, Melvin and Marie Faulkner of Wanette, Okla.; daughters and sons-in-law, Carolyn Walling Wallace and Bob Wallace of Olathe, Colo. and Charlene Walling White and Ray White of Penn Valley; grandchildren, Robert Wallace and wife, Dianne, of Beaverton, Ore., Carol Ann and husband, Bill Zick, of Sahuarita, Ariz., Bob White and wife, Maryann of Woodlake, Don White of Grass Valley, Ron White and wife, Marjan of Redding and Glenn White of Vacaville; six great-grandchildren, six great-great-grandchildren; and numerous cousins, nieces and nephews in Oklahoma, Missouri, Texas, Tennessee, Washington and Indiana. She was preceded in death by her mother and father, husband of 63 years, Bob Walling, in 1996; brothers, Earl, Elra, Kile, Fred, J.W. and Frank Faulkner.

Mrs. Walling was a very caring and loving person and was known for her beautiful eyes and smile. She loved her family, God and babies.
